Transaction 8f7df124f5b9519a256dbcf2d7768c1540a71e28ee080edb707edefcecb44d79

1 Input
2 Outputs
  • 8f7df124f5b9519a256dbcf2d7768c1540a71e28ee080edb707edefcecb44d79:0
  • value  5254581343
    address  18cpS58GHfGs1ZMoTq1AnEGJEBrtLz7gV
  • 8f7df124f5b9519a256dbcf2d7768c1540a71e28ee080edb707edefcecb44d79:1
  • value  38655643
    address  151mUEHrCnTbzEJd7qii5Np7LE5iBjjdqe